Let $\text{f}:\text{R}-\Big\{-\frac{4}{3}\Big\}\rightarrow\text{R}$ be a function defined as $f(\text{x})=\frac{4\text{x}}{3\text{x}+4}.$ The inverse of f is the map g: Range $\text{f}:\text{R}-\Big\{-\frac{4}{3}\Big\}\rightarrow\text{R}$ given by:
- A$\text{g}(\text{y})=\frac{3\text{y}}{3-4\text{y}}$
- ✓$\text{g}(\text{y})=\frac{4\text{y}}{4-3\text{y}}$
- C$\text{g}(\text{y})=\frac{4\text{y}}{3-4\text{y}}$
- D$\text{g}(\text{y})=\frac{3\text{y}}{4-3\text{y}}.$
